For businesses in Dubai and across the UAE, this matters even more because the region has one of the highest smartphone penetration rates in the world. Mobile commerce is growing rapidly, consumers expect fast digital experiences, and search engines prioritize mobile usability.
According to recent UAE digital reports, more than 96 percent of internet users access the internet through mobile devices. Mobile phones also account for over 75 percent of web traffic in the UAE.
So if your website is not optimized for real user device behavior, you lose traffic, rankings, and sales.

Why Device Behavior Matters in Dubai?
Dubai is one of the most digitally connected cities in the world.
Consumers in the UAE are highly mobile driven. Fast internet, widespread 5G adoption, and strong ecommerce growth have changed how people interact online.
According to UAE smartphone reports:
- The UAE has approximately 10.8 million smartphone users
- Smartphone penetration is around 95 percent
- Mobile commerce is rapidly increasing
- Consumers spend more than 8 hours daily online across devices
- Social media usage exceeds 2 hours and 58 minutes daily on average
This creates a mobile first economy.

How Device Behavior Affects SEO
Device behavior plays a direct role in SEO performance.
Google measures user interaction signals across devices.
These include:
- Bounce rate
- Time on site
- Mobile usability
- Page speed
- Core Web Vitals
- Navigation quality
- Responsive design
If mobile users leave your site quickly, rankings may decline.
Since most UAE traffic comes from smartphones, mobile SEO is now essential.
Google uses mobile first indexing, meaning it primarily evaluates the mobile version of your website for rankings.
This means your mobile experience must be excellent.

Key Device Behavior Metrics Businesses Should Track
Understanding device behavior requires analytics.
Important metrics include:
Bounce Rate by Device
Shows how users behave across mobile, desktop, and tablet.
Average Session Duration
Measures engagement quality.
Conversion Rate by Device
Helps identify which devices generate revenue.
Cart Abandonment Rate
Important for ecommerce businesses.
Mobile Page Speed
Critical for SEO and user retention.
Device Flow Tracking
Shows how users switch between devices.
Google Analytics 4 is commonly used to monitor these insights.
